TU9-90-033 ANTI-SKATING CONTROL OF A POSITIONING SERVO SYSTEM ABSTRACT OF THE DISCLOSURE A servo positioning system, such as used in an optical disk or other types of disk drives includes focus and positioning servo circuits. When a focus error is detected, then it is desired to stop the operation of the positioning system. Similarly, when a positioning error is detected, such as excessive speed or a non-zero velocity at the end of a seek or positioning motion, the head carriage should also be stopped. The stopping of the head carriage is by dynamic braking through use of a power amplifier which is switched from a transconductance mode used during normal servo positioning operations to a voltage amplifying mode which is set to a zero input for dynamically braking the servo positioning system to a safe speed and thence to a stop condition whereupon further error recovery procedures may be employed.
